A Life Science application has the history to which the format and/or the name of file have been decided mutually without order. When one file is applied to name, each researcher applies a probably different name even the file is completely the same content.
Even same naming rule applied in some project, the other similar project is not necessarily applied to the same rule. Even same rule applied in one organization, it is hard to understand the file content without scanning the real file by the other organization. We think that this is a big barrier for an interoperability among life science project.

Many life science grid project had challenged this kind of the naming problem, then catalog service is one of the solution for the purpose. The service allows us to identify a content without scanner. Any user can access the catalog data, then the user understand what it is. Some workflow engine can manage the prerequisite process for the next transition point. However we don’t have any standard catalog entry for life science research project. Thus, we still have same problem for an interoperability among an inter-grid project.

In the OGF, Grid File System Working Group (GFS-WG) had published a proposed recommendation such as “Resource Namespace Service Specification” in Sep 6, 2006. The document describes the specification of the Resource Namespace Service (RNS) which offers a standard way for mapping names to any resource within distributed environnant.
GFS-WG had designed the specification for catalog service for implementing the grid file service. However, the RNS can add the catalog profile that specializes in life science, with the GFS-Profile because the extendibility is very abundant.
Therefore, LSR-Profile WG works on defining for Life Science Resource Profile based on RNS specification.
